Charles Schwab: An Overview

Analyze the company's history, development, and growth

Charles Schwab is one of America's largest financial services firms. It has positioned itself in the financial services market as a firm for the 'average investor.' It was a pioneer of the no-transaction fee mutual fund, a financial instrument that became increasingly important for investors without a great deal of initial capital. Schwab opened up storefronts all over the nation, and was one of the first firms to use direct face-to-face contact with average, small-scale investors as a marketing technique. Its low fees and personal touch caused Schwab to experience stratospheric growth during the 1990s stock market boom, an era which saw a rapid influx of new investors into the marketplace. The firm also pioneered aggressive advertising to the consumer in the popular media. The popularity of day trading or quick trades made Schwab's low-cost model particularly attractive. However, the recent credit crunch has meant that Charles Schwab must rethink its strategy (Charles Schwab, 2011, Reference for Business).

Identify the company's internal strengths and weaknesses

Schwab has been swift to capitalize upon deregulation of the financial industry. In fact, it could be said that deregulation was the most important component of Schwab's success: "On May 1, 1975, the U.S. Congress deregulated the stock brokerage industry by taking away the power of the New York Stock Exchange to determine the commission rates charged by its members. This opened the door to discount brokers, who took orders to buy and sell securities, but did not offer advice or do research the way larger, established brokers such as Merrill Lynch did" (Charles Schwab, 2011, Reference for Business).

During the period when it was owned by the Bank of America in the 1980s, Schwab began to chafe under the additional regulations that it was placed under as a result of being owned by a bank. Schwab continued searching for ways to become less dependent on commissions. "The introduction in July 1992 of the Mutual Fund OneSource, a program allowing investors to trade mutual funds (more than 200 in all) from eight outside fund companies, without paying any transaction fees, attracted more than $500 million in assets within two months and over $4 billion by July 1993; it was thus the most successful first-year pilot of any new service in Schwab's history" (Charles Schwab, 2011, Reference for Business). Deregulation of the banking industry later freed Schwab and other firms connected to banks from some of the regulatory constraints limiting the risks they could take.

The nature of the external environment surrounding the company

Schwab's growth coincided with the financial sector's deregulation. The further spurred interest in the company amongst the small investors that have always been its lifeblood. Schwab's assets, like all firms, were hard-hit by the dot.com bubble and the real estate bubble's burst, and while hardened investors often use such times to buy up assets in the hopes that they will appreciate over the long-term, many of the small investors that were Schwab's bread-and-butter have left the investment marketplace entirely.
